How do you iron a Cal. King fitted sheet in the shortest time?


Question:I'd like it ironed the professional way without sending it out to the laudromat. It took me close to an hour to iron a set of bedding linens. How can I cut down the time?

Answers:
You need to buy an iron press. This has a large ironing surface that presses down with about 100 lbs of pressure so you can iron 4 layers at the same time.

I've seen them on EBay or just google iron press.

If you want them nice and flat and clean too, hang them outside on a clothes line... they smell great and the wind irons them for you... Save energy.do it the old fashioned way.
As you are drying them, open the dryer and move them around a bit so they don't get bunched up. Also, leave room for them to tumble. Don't overload and you can also use a wrinkle release spray as you are drying.
"LIne" dry them. Dryers make wrinkles.
